Vietnamese scrap import market creeps up

Scrap import prices are rising in Vietnam, Kallanish notes. While most buyers continue to resist paying higher values, overseas suppliers are also withholding offers in the rising market. Offers for US scrap are generally limited in the market now. “Sellers want to see how the market develops; they think the market is increasing,” a Hanoi trader says.
